- Point-of-Use Filtration Systems - Ideal for households seeking to improve tap water quality for daily use.
- Whole-House Water Filters - Suitable for residents wanting to treat water supply for the entire home in Northville and surrounding areas.
- Reverse Osmosis Systems - Recommended for those needing to remove contaminants from drinking water sources.
- UV Water Purification - Used when there is a concern about bacteria or viruses in the water supply.
- Sediment and Carbon Filters - Appropriate for addressing common issues like sediment, chlorine taste, or odor in municipal or well water.

One of the primary issues addressed by water filtration services is the removal of contaminants that can affect health and water quality. These contaminants may include chlorine, sediment, heavy metals, bacteria, and other pollutants that can cause discoloration, odors, or health concerns. Filtration systems help mitigate these problems, providing a solution for households experiencing issues like foul odors, cloudy water, or mineral buildup. By improving water quality, these services contribute to the overall safety and comfort of daily water usage.
Various types of properties utilize water filtration services, ranging from single-family homes to multi-unit residential buildings. Homeowners with private wells often seek filtration systems to address specific well water issues, while urban properties connected to municipal water supplies may opt for additional filtration to enhance taste and remove residual chemicals. Commercial properties, such as small businesses or hospitality establishments, may also require filtration solutions to ensure water quality for customers and employees. The versatility of these services allows them to accommodate the needs of different property types and water sources.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a home water filtration system typically ranges from $300 to $1,500, depending on the system type and complexity. Basic under-sink units tend to be on the lower end, while whole-house systems may be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Replacement Filters - Replacement filters generally cost between $20 and $100 each, with more advanced or larger filters being more expensive. The frequency of replacement varies, but annual costs can add up depending on the system used.
Maintenance Expenses - Routine maintenance for water filtration systems usually falls between $50 and $200 annually. This includes filter changes, system checks, and minor repairs performed by local service providers.
Additional Equipment - Upgrades or additional components, such as UV purifiers or mineral filters, can add $200 to $1,000 to the initial setup. Costs vary based on the features selected and the size of the household in Northville, MI area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How does a home water filtration service work? Home water filtration services typically involve installing systems that remove contaminants and impurities from tap water, improving its quality and taste. Local service providers can evaluate your water and recommend suitable filtration options.
What types of water filtration systems are available? Common systems include activated carbon filters, reverse osmosis units, and UV purifiers. Local professionals can help determine which type best meets your household's needs.
Is professional installation necessary for water filtration systems? Yes, professional installation ensures the system is set up correctly and functions properly. Contact local pros to handle the installation process.
How often should I replace or maintain my water filter? Maintenance frequency varies by system type and usage but generally involves replacing filters every few months. Local service providers can advise on maintenance schedules.
Can a water filtration system improve the taste of my tap water? Yes, many filtration systems effectively remove odors and impurities, resulting in better-tasting water. A local water treatment expert can recommend the best solution for taste improvement.
